WA7 2RN is a postcode in Halton Lea, Halton, North West, England. The demographic profile for WA7 2RN is based on Halton 016 Census 2021. It covers 6,253 residents, 1,590 people per square kilometre. The median age is around 50, helping show whether the area skews younger, family-sized or older. Housing tenure is 90% owner-occupied, 7% privately rented, 2% social rented, useful context for renters, buyers and landlords comparing the local property market. On the official England neighbourhood wellbeing index the area ranks in decile 8/10.
For property prices near WA7 2RN, LocaleIQ uses Land Registry sold-price evidence for the WA7 postcode district. The latest median sold price is £135k from 70 rolling sales. The Property tab separates flats, terraced, semi-detached and detached homes where enough sales exist.
